  • Sea buckthorn (Hippophae rhamnoides L.) is deciduous shrubs in the genus Hippophae, mainly cultivated in Europe and Asia. Sea buckthorn berries have a high vitamin C, vitamin E, carotenoids, carbohydrates, protein, organic acids, dietary minerals, triterpenoids, polyphenolic acids and amino acids. Extracts of sea buckthorn berries have anti- obesity, anti-oxidantive, anti-microbial, anti-ulcerogenic, anti-diabetic and nutritional effects. Sea buckthorn used as a traditional medicine for the treatment of cough, aid digestion, invigorate blood circulation and alleviate pain. Extracts of sea buckthorn branches and leaves was administered to humans and animals to treat gastrointestinal distress in Mongolia. This paper briefly reviews the most relevant experimental data on the pharmacological effects and isolated component of sea buckthorn. And, we also describe the importance of sea buckthorn as the environmental-friendly crops.

Chemical Composition of Mongolian Sea-buckthorn (Hippophae rhamnoides L.) Fruits

  • Sea-buckthorn fruits (Hippophae rhamnoides L.) are used in Mongolia as traditional medicine due to the health-benefits associated with its bioactive components. The purpose of this study was to investigate the chemical composition of Mongolian sea-buckthorn fruits. In terms of proximate composition, crude fat content was the highest, whereas its crude ash content was the lowest. In organic acid contents, malic acid content ($6.30{\pm}0.005$ mg/g) was the highest. Free sugars were composed of sucrose, xylose, glucose and mannitol. Vitamin C and carotenoid content were 320 mg/100 g and 715.25 mg/100 g, respectively. The major fatty acids were palmitic (C16:0), palmitoleic (C16:1), caprylic (C8:0) and linoleic (C18:2) acid.

  • The purpose of this study was to prepare bread added with sea buckthorn (Hippophae rhamnoides L.) berry powder (SBBP) (1, 3, and 5%) using a straight dough method. The quality and antioxidant characteristics of the bread were analyzed. The results indicated that the pH value and dough raising power of the dough decreased and the moisture content of the bread added with SBBP increased compared to that without the SBBP. The crust color of the bread did not change significantly. However, the crumb lightness value decreased and the redness and yellowness value increased respectively to the concentration of the SBBP. The texture measurement indicated that the hardness, gumminess, and chewiness of the bread increased with the addition of the SBBP. The total polyphenol content of the bread supplemented with the SBBP was increased (4.60~16.14 mg GAE/g) compare to the control (1.67 mg GAE/g). Dose-dependent, significant-high DPPH (26.86%) and ABTS (42.52%) radical scavenging activities were observed in the bread with the addition of the SBBP up to 5%. Based on these results, the optimum amount of the SBBP to add for baking bread would be 3% and the SBBP could be considered a functional agent.

Sea Buckthorn (Hippophae rhamnoides L.) Leaf Extracts Protect Neuronal PC-12 Cells from Oxidative Stress

  • The present study was carried out to investigate the antioxidative and neuroprotective effects of sea buckthorn (Hippophae rhamnoides L.) leaves (SBL) harvested at different times. Reversed-phase high-performance liquid chromatography analysis revealed five major phenolic compounds: ellagic acid, gallic acid, isorhamnetin, kaempferol, and quercetin. SBL harvested in August had the highest total phenolic and flavonoid contents and antioxidant capacity. Treatment of neuronal PC-12 cells with the ethyl acetate fraction of SBL harvested in August increased their viability and membrane integrity and reduced intracellular oxidative stress in a dose-dependent manner. The relative populations of both early and late apoptotic PC-12 cells were decreased by treatment with the SBL ethyl acetate fraction, based on flow cytometry analysis using annexin V-FITC/PI staining. These findings suggest that SBL can serve as a good source of antioxidants and medicinal agents that attenuate oxidative stress.

  • 본 연구에서는 비타민나무의 기능성 소재 개발을 위한 기초 자료로 활용하기 위해 일반 성분, 이화학적특성 중 총 페놀함량과 DPPH free radical 소거활성, SOD 유사활성, Hydroxy radical scavenging activity를 이용한 항산화활성을 측정하였다. 비타민나무는 잎, 잔가지, 굵은 가지, 뿌리의 4가지 부위를 물과 에탄올을 용매로 추출하여 실험에 사용한 결과, 일반 성분의 경우 비타민 나무의 모든 부위에서 조회분과 조단백질의 함량이 에탄올 추출물보다 물 추출물에서 더 높은 것으로 확인되었다. 총 폴리페놀함량은 잎과 뿌리 부위해서 높은 결과를 보였으며, 물 추출물에 비해서 에탄올 추출물의 함량이 더 높은 것으로 확인되었다. DPPH radical 제거활성은 잔가지를 제외한 부위에서 에탄올 추출물보다 물 추출물이 높은 활성을 보였고, 특이적으로 에탄올을 용매로 한 잔가지 추출물의 $IC_{50}$이 23.58${\pm}$0.84%로 가장 높은 활성을 나타내었다. SOD 유사활성능은 물 추출물보다 에탄올 추출물이 높았으며, 그 중 잔가지의 에탄올 추출물이 35.03${\pm}$2.33%의 가장 높은 활성을 나타내었다. Hydroxy radical scavenging 활성은 에탄올 추출물이 물 추출물에 비해 2배 이상의 높은 활성을 보였고, 그 중 뿌리 부위의 에탄올 추출물이 66.12${\pm}$8.73%의 높은 활성을 보였다. 결과적으로 본 연구에서는 비타민나무 추출물의 영양학적 가치와 항산화활성을 확인하였고, 그로 인한 기능성소재로써의 개발이 가능할 수 있음을 확인하였다.

  • This study was performed to investigate the antioxidative properties of sea buckthorn (Hippophae rhamnoides L.; leaf, fruit and stem) and the quality characteristics of brown rice sulgidduk prepared using a powder of sea buckthorn leaves. First, the antioxidative activities of sea buckthorn were measured to choose the most effective part of this plant. By analyzing the measured values, we concluded that the effective part of sea buckthorn was its leaves. The $IC_{50}$ value of the DPPH radical scavenging activity and the ABTS radical scavenging activity in sea buckthorn leaves were $7.78{\mu}g/mL$ and $264.04{\mu}g/mL$, respectively. The total polyphenol and total flavonoid contents of sea buckthorn leaves were 3.80 mg/mL and .19 mg/mL, respectively. Therefore, the brown rice sulgidduk was prepared using a powder of sea buckthorn leaves in the weight ratio of 0%, .5%, 1.0%, 1.5%, 2.0% and 2.5%. For analyzing the quality characteristics of the prepared sulgidduk, proximate compositions, color and texture profiles were measured and a sensory evaluation was conducted. With an increase in the added content of the sea buckthorn leaf powder (SBLP), the L-value significantly decreased while the a-value and the b-value increased. In the case of texture profiles, the control group (control A) had a higher score for hardness than the case groups in which the SBLP was added. However, springiness, chewiness and adhesiveness were not significantly different among the groups. In the sensory evaluation, the sample containing 1.5% SBLP yielded the best results. Therefore, we suggest that the powder of sea buckthorn leaves is a good ingredient for increasing the consumer acceptability and functionality of sulgidduk.

The Effect of Extract from Sea Buckthorn on DNCB-induced Atopic Dermatitis in NC/Nga Mice

  • Sea Buckthorn (Hippophae rhamnoides L.) has been used in traditional medicine for the treatment of cough, indigestion, circulatory problems and pain. The associated anti-inflammatory effect of this agent is achieved via the inhibition of Nf-${\kappa}B$ signaling, a property that has been demonstrated to effectively control the symptoms of various skin disorders, including atopic dermatitis. Accordingly, the purpose of this study was to assess the efficacy of Sea Buckthorn in reducing the production of lipopolysaccharide (LPS) activated nitric oxide (NO) by inhibiting the Nf-${\kappa}B$ pathway, as measured by the symptoms of atopic dermatitis (AD) occurring secondarily to inflammation and immune dysregulation. Our data demonstrate that Sea Buckthorn significantly decreased the LPS-induced production of NO (p<0.001). Atopic dermatitis was induced by repeated application of 2,4-dinitrochlorobenzene to the dorsal skin of mice. Topical application of 5% Sea Buckthorn extract improved the symptoms of AD, specifically reducing disease severity scores, scratching behaviors and epidermal thickness. When compared to the control group, animals treated with Sea Buckthorn exhibited increased serum IL-12 levels and decreased serum TNF-${\alpha}$, IL-4 and IL-5 levels. Such a modulation of biphasic T-helper (Th)1/Th2 cytokines may result in a reduction in serum IgE levels. Our findings suggest that mechanism of action of Sea Buckthorn in the treatment of AD is associated with a marked anti-inflammatory effect as well as an inhibition of Th2-mediated IgE overproduction via the modulation of biphasic Th1/Th2 cytokines. Such results suggest that topical Sea Buckthorn extract may prove to be a novel therapy for AD symptoms with few side effects.

  • Sea buckthorn (Hippophae rhamnoides L.)은 flavonoid, carotenoids, steroids, vitamin, tannins, oleic acid 등의 생물학적으로 활성이 높은 성분을 풍부하게 함유하고 있어 오랫동안 피부질환(skin diseases), 위궤양(gastric ulcers), 천식(asthma), 폐질환 등에 사용되어 왔다. 본 연구에서는 아시아와 유럽의 고지대에서 야생으로 자라는 Sea buckthorn의 열매추출물(SBFE)이 UV조사 후 유도되는 세포사와 연관성을 규명하기 위하여, 세포사와 관련된 다양한 인자의 변화를 관찰하였다. 그 결과, 세포사를 유발할 수 있는 UV조사농도는 400 mJ로 설정하였고, 세포생존율은 UV + LoC, UV + MeC, UV + HiC 처리군에서는 유의적으로 증가하였다. 또한 FACS와 DAPI염색의 결과에서 PI로 염색된 세포수는 UV + vehicle 처리군에서 급격히 증가한 이후 UV + SBFE 처리군에서 유의적으로 감소하였고, Annexin V가 염색된 세포 수는 고농도의 SFBE을 처리한 UV + HiC 처리군에서 유의적으로 감소하였다. 그러나 PI와 Annexin V가 동시에 염색된 세포의 수는 UV + LoC 처리군에서 오히려 증가하였고 나머지 그룹에서는 유의적인 변화가 관찰되지 않았다. 한편, 세포사와 관련된 단백질의 변화에 대한 연구에서 caspase-3는 pro 형태와 active 형태 모두에서 유의적인 차이를 나타내지 않았으며, Bax와 Bcl-2 모두 UV 무처리군에 비하여 UV + Vehicle 처리군에서 감소하였으나 Bax의 발현양은 UV + SBFE 처리군에서 농도의존적으로 증가한 반면, Bcl-2의 발현양은 UV + SBFE 처리군에서 추가적으로 더욱 감소하였다. 따라서 이상의 결과들은 SBFE가 UV조사에 의해 유도된 세포사를 억제하거나 회복시키는 기능을 가지고 있음을 제시하고 있어 향후 UV조사에 의해 유발되는 다양한 상해에 대한 치료제로서의 가능성을 제시하고 있다.
